Hi Lawyer team, I (am a Christian) purchased a flat in 2005 from the 2nd owner in MHADA premises by providing all the required documents (registration fees and stamp duty). Society is now 40 years old and will start for re-development in Pune. When i reached MHADA office they told me that the 2nd owner have not complete stamp duty formalities and now have to pay the amount. Do i need to pay the amount of the 2nd owner? Regards, Wilson

Yes, ideally you are suppose to check whether previous stamp duty is paid by the 2 nd owner, as all transfer above value of Rs. 100 need to be registered, and for immovable property stamp duty has to be paid. Also check with the previous owner for receipts of stamp duty paid, between 1st and 2 nd owner.
